You will actually get white and black dots , the black ones are tougher to see because of the color in the background , within 2 months youre picture will be fully covered with dots....I went through the Samsung website troubleshooting flow chart , and it led me to a bad Digital Micromiror Device , or DMD board . What is actually the problem is the DMV chip connected to this board . Inside this chip are 3 million tiny mirrors ,and when they physically get stuck , they either show black or white instead of a color . Samsung will not tell me the part number of the chip , they will only offer to send a service tech to my house .
SOURCE: I have black spots on my samsung dlp tv
I had the same problem with my Samsung DLP tv a couple of weeks ago. I had to clean the lenses, mirrors and the DMD sensor to fix it, you must remove the rear cover to do this. If the mirrors and lenses were cleaned but the spots were still there, the final thing to do is to clean the sensor chip on the DMD board. It is located under the heat sink behind the small fan in the lower center of the rear of the TV. The DMD board will have to be removed to get to the back of the sensor. All you have to do is blow some dry canned air across it to remove the dust, do not wipe it with anything. The repair is somewhat complicated and you will probably have to realign the picture by adjusting the position of the DMD board when finished.
